EPG Wealth Management's LDUR Position: Q4 2022 in Review

EPG Wealth Management sold out of PIMCO Enhanced Low Duration Active Exchange-Traded Fund (LDUR) in Q4 2022, closing a stake of 334 shares — an estimated $32K sold.

EPG Wealth Management first reported a position in LDUR in Q1 2020 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$35K in Q1 2020. 162 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old LDUR as of Q4 2022.
